Transaction 3df76e4fd51107a3f57a1d17607213f8194aadb74e4a0b632e69ff55c4f61fc7
1 Input
1 Output
-
3df76e4fd51107a3f57a1d17607213f8194aadb74e4a0b632e69ff55c4f61fc7:0
- value
- 412902526
- script pubkey
- OP_0 OP_PUSHBYTES_20 a5cc787fd185d3caf3546339340032838e9b2370
- address
- bc1q5hx8sl73shfu4u65vvungqpjsw8fkgms9nrja0